Nascar – Keselowski emerges from Talladega chaos

After Las Vegas (Nevada), Brad Keselowski (Team Penske) signed his second victory of the season, the 19th of his career and the fourth on this superspeedway, by winning the Geico 500 at Talladega (Alabama). The 2012 champion remained at the front in the last part of the race, allowing him to avoid the series of pileups that marked the event.

Fearing that the race would be interrupted by rain, the drivers quickly jostled to place themselves in the best positions. Among the most impressive crashes, Chris Buescher (Front Row Motorsports) stood out by ending his weekend with a series of rollovers.

Matt Kenseth (Joe Gibbs Racing) flew away and ended up in the guardrails after colliding with Danica Patrick (Stewart-Haas Racing).

The most impressive accident will remain the Big One on lap 161 involving 21 cars. Kurt Busch (Stewart-Haas Racing) was the unwitting cause after pushing Jimmie Johnson (Hendrick Motorsports) as the peloton approached a corner.
